"I just want to leave Ghan" -Kuffour

Fri, 12 Apr 2002 Source:  

Accra Hearts of Oak and Black Stars unsettle striker Emmanuel Osei Kufour has denied reports that he has signed a new two year deal with the defending league champions.

He admitted meeting the board chairman of Hearts of Oak Mr. Ato Ahowi last week but said no concrete arrangement was concluded, as Hearts proposal of the player earning additional 15 % of any possible transfer outside Ghana was not good.


“I just want to leave Ghana and play anywhere,” he told a radio station, “I must tell you I am going to play in the U.S. major league definitely.”


Osei Kuffour emerged as the top soccer in the 2000 Champion’s league with ten goals, which Hearts won, has gone on trials with a number of foreign teams including former European giants Benfica.

‘Hearts News’ the official newspaper of Hearts of Oak last week reported that Osei Kuffour has agreed to a new two-year deal with the defending league champions.


The player who recently had trials with a Chinese first division side has refused to play for Hearts since the latter part of last season
